About This Landmark

Scenic Waterfall Escape at Glade Creek Falls

Glade Creek Falls is a captivating natural destination in Raleigh County, West Virginia, that offers an inviting blend of beauty and tranquility. Located near the New River Gorge region, this waterfall stands out as one of the area’s most charming features, drawing visitors seeking both relaxation and light adventure. The falls cascade gracefully over smooth rock faces into a clear, inviting pool, creating a vivid experience framed by rich green forests typical of this Appalachian area.

The striking waterfall is the star attraction here. Its gentle but steady flow cuts through moss-covered rocks, making it an excellent spot for photos, picnics, and quiet reflection. Surrounding the stream, the native hardwood forest provides shelter to local wildlife, including colorful birds and shy deer, presenting a perfect spot for nature observers and photographers. The Glade Creek area also boasts diverse plant life, a draw for anyone interested in regional flora. Historically, the area has been appreciated for decades as part of West Virginia’s preserved wilderness, connected to broader efforts to protect the New River Gorge and its natural treasures.

Visitors reach Glade Creek Falls via an accessible but peaceful hiking trail, which meanders alongside the creek and offers glimpses of the waterfall from various vantage points. The trail can be muddy in places and the final approach to the water requires some caution, but the effort is rewarded with an up-close view ideal for swimming or simply enjoying the cool spray on a warm day. This spot lends itself well to a half-day outing, offering a refreshing break from city life amid some of Appalachia’s most scenic landscapes.


Adventure Guide To Glade Creek Falls

1. Hiking to Glade Creek Falls Trailhead

  • What makes it special: A 4-5 mile roundtrip trail following Glade Creek through mixed hardwood forests with moderate elevation changes.
  • Key features: Multiple viewpoints of waterfalls and creek cascades; shaded paths with benches for rest.
  • Local insights: The trail is well-maintained but can get muddy after rain, so waterproof boots are recommended.
  • Visitor tips: Best visited in spring or early summer when water flow is strong and foliage is vibrant. Bring insect repellent and water.

2. Swimming and Picnic by the Falls

  • What makes it special: The clear pool at the falls offers a refreshing spot for a natural swim, especially on warmer days.
  • Key features: Smooth rocks suitable for sunbathing and picnic breaks near the water; clean surroundings encourage responsible use.
  • Local insights: Locals advise packing out all trash to preserve the area’s pristine quality.
  • Visitor tips: Arrive early on weekends to enjoy a quieter setting. Bring swimwear, towels, and dry shoes for the hike back.

3. Wildlife Watching and Photography

  • What makes it special: The rich forest habitat supports birds such as warblers and woodpeckers, with occasional deer sightings.
  • Key features: Diverse native plants and quiet creek environments provide excellent photo opportunities.
  • Local insights: Early mornings offer the best chance to see wildlife with minimal disturbance.
  • Visitor tips: Carry binoculars and a camera with a zoom lens. Respect wildlife distance and avoid loud noises.

Getting There

  • Glade Creek Falls is approximately a 40-minute drive from Beckley, WV. From Beckley, take WV-3 north towards the New River Gorge area before turning onto Glade Creek Road. Parking is available near the trailhead.
  • Check weather forecasts for trail conditions, especially during spring rains or fall leaf season.
